Pass, move, cut. When you shoot, shoot low. Try not to fall, it wil kill especially on the artifical grass (not the carpet stuff but that will kill too, but the little balls will hurt on the other stuff). And basically, indoor is not season, so work on you lefty and because it probably wont be as intense, just work on you skills that need to be worked on. Indoor is a great time to practice things against an actual team with out having to sacrifice the possesion or a score like in season when it would matter.
